A Symphony of Light and Motion

In the realm of early twentieth-century abstraction, few works capture the electric pulse of modernity as vibrantly as Mikhail Fiodorovich Larionov’s Blue Rayonism. This masterpiece serves as a breathtaking window into the Rayonist movement, an avant-garde revolution that sought to move beyond the mere depiction of objects to capture the very essence of light itself. Rather than presenting a static landscape or a recognizable cityscape, Larionov invites the viewer into a world of pure energy. The canvas is a dense, rhythmic web of intersecting lines and sharp geometric fragments, where the boundaries between solid matter and luminous radiation dissolve. It is an experience of visual vibration, where every stroke feels as though it is caught in a moment of intense, kinetic transformation.

The technical brilliance of Blue Rayonism lies in its masterful manipulation of color and form to simulate the sensation of sight. Utilizing what appears to be the delicate yet potent medium of watercolor or gouache, Larionov employs a palette of striking contrasts. Deep, resonant blues dominate the composition, suggesting the cool depth of light reflecting off unseen surfaces, while sudden bursts of fiery red and organic green inject a sense of heat and vitality into the arrangement. These colors do not merely sit upon the paper; they collide and overlap, creating a flattened yet complex perspective that denies traditional depth in favor of a layered, prismatic effect. The visible brushwork adds a tactile, human element to the abstraction, grounding the cosmic energy of the rays in the physical movement of the artist’s hand.

The Spirit of Rayonism and Symbolic Resonance

To understand this work is to understand the historical moment of its creation—a period of profound upheaval and scientific discovery. Larionov, a pioneer of the Russian avant-garde, moved away from the academic rigor of his youth to embrace a style that mirrored the rapid acceleration of the modern age. In Blue Rayonism, the subject matter is not a place, but a phenomenon. The artist utilizes symbolism through color to evoke an emotional landscape: the blue represents the fluid movement of energy, the red embodies passion and the friction of light, and the green hints at the underlying pulse of nature. This is art stripped of its literal skin, revealing the skeletal structure of light rays that Larionov believed connected all things in the universe.
